I have a few questions about 4-FA, here goes:

IS 4-FA a serotonin releaser or rather an agonist/antagonist? (I'm on an SSRI and was wondering if i was getting the serotoninergic effects)

How long does it take for ones dopamine levels to get back to normal after say 2 doses during the evening of 150mg of 4-FA?

In laymens terms, what is 4-FA's "rapport" with dopamine, and does it act on any other neurotransmitters or "things"?

And what is it's half life?

thanks
 
It is a serotonin and dopamine releaser and reuptake inhibitor. Combining this with an SSRI is thus bad news.
From wikipedia, here's a list of releasing agents of serotonin, dopamin and norepinephrine.
http://en.wikipedia.org/wiki/Releasing_agent

It does release dopamine, even more so than 'normal' amphetamine. How long it takes for your dopamine to recover is impossible to say AFAIK.
